• FinOps Specialist manages analyses and optimizes cloud expenditure by aligning engineering finance and business teams They are responsible for implementing cloud costsaving strategies forecasting usage improving cost transparency and fostering a culture of financial accountability across cloud platforms like AWS Azure or GCP

 

Key Responsibilities

Cloud Cost Optimization Analyze usage patterns to identify and implement costsaving opportunities such as reserved instances or resource scheduling

Financial Modelling Forecasting Develop budgets track spending anomalies and forecast future cloud expenditures

CrossFunctional Collaboration Act as a bridge between technical teams engineeringDevOps and finance to ensure efficient resource allocation

Reporting Governance Create dashboards establish policies for accountability and provide actionable insights to leadership

Vendor Management Negotiate pricing and manage relationships with cloud service providers
